Overview:

Vintage Art Deco era natural sapphire (heated) cocktail ring (circa 1930s) crafted in 14 karat white gold.

Cabochon cut Ceylon origin natural sapphire measures 15mm x 7mm (estimated at 7.50 carats). The sapphire is in good condition with some light abrasions visible under a 10x loupe. The sapphire has eye visible inclusions. 

Green, black, and red frame the sapphire and adds a beautiful pop of color to the ring. The die struck lacy filigree mount is a feast for the eyes and a great example of Art Deco era jewelry design. The captivating ring makes a great statement on the hand with a medium rise (10mm - 0.39 inches). 

The ring is in good condition. We have not cleaned the ring in order to preserve the patina and collector value.
